Disability shower installation services involve modifying or creating showers that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a safe and functional bathing environment that allows users to maintain independence and reduce the risk of accidents or falls during showering activities.
These services address common issues fa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or navigating narrow, slippery spaces. Installing accessible showers can eliminate barriers that make bathing difficult or unsafe, thereby enhancing safety and comfort. Additionally, these modifications can help caregivers assist with bathing tasks more easily, contributing to a more manageable routine for both users and their support systems.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saddle Brook,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features can increase expenses.
Material Expenses - Material costs for disability showers vary widely, with prices from $300 to $2,500. Choices like accessible tiles, grab bars, and non-slip flooring influence the overall budget.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for professional installation usually fall between $500 and $2,000. Factors such as site preparation and additional plumbing work can affect the final cost.
Additional Features - Optional upgrades like seating, specialized fixtures, or waterproofing may add $200 to $1,000 or more to the total exp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s and preferences.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
